As I grow older, I find more useful to write than to read.
I write every day of the week, while I generally reserve the weekend for reading books. That's not to say I don't read (of course, I read every day too), but the intentional act of slowing down to read is something I do less these days.
Writing forces me to wrestle with my thoughts, my half-formed ideas, my pre-judices, my beliefs, and my wrong convictions.
It is an art that I'd recommend everyone should pick up.
When I was young(er), I used to read more than I used to write. These days, it's the other way around.
